Heads up for support: the Routeline driver-assignment heuristic changed defaults in 4.2. Proximity weighting now dominates over acceptance-rate history, the stale-ping cutoff dropped sharply, and batch matching is on by default. Expect tickets about drivers getting jobs farther from their usual zones and fewer long-idle drivers receiving offers. Tenants who pinned 4.1 values are unaffected. Point customers at the tuning doc before escalating. The new default values shipping with 4.2 are listed below.

deployment values, tafof-taduf:
pelius:
  pin: 6508
  tenant: praiel
  seal: seal_4e33a2f4
  metrics_host: metrics.pelius.plorvagrid.corp
  standby_team: druix
  escalation: juldor-norius
  nonce: 5db598

Hiring Freeze — Calder Division (Managers Only)

Effective immediately, all open requisitions in the Calder division are frozen. Exceptions require VP sign-off. Finance: exclude frozen roles from the Q4 payroll forecast and flag any offers already extended. Freeze review date is end of quarter. Rationale, restricted to this page, follows:

board note of kageg-bahof: The renewal with Holwynax Holdings closes at $2 million a year, 5 percent below the last contract. Project Ulaath slips by two quarters because of the supplier delay.

# Env Vars: Planner Regression Mitigation

After the query planner regression in Corvid DB 9.3, Fernwell's release builds must pin the legacy planner until the patched build ships. Set `CORVID_PLANNER_MODE=legacy` in the release env file and confirm it with the preflight check before tagging. The planner override endpoint requires authentication, so the release env file also needs the planner override token on the next line.

env line for kahof-fajeg: ARCHIVE_KEY3=397

MEMO — Heads of Department

Subject: Term Sheet from Pellway Group

Quick heads-up: Pellway Group finally sent over their term sheet for the distribution tie-up on the Sonder line. It's better than expected — stronger revenue share, shorter lock-in — but they want co-branding rights we're not sure about. Jun Abelard is running point; please send any deal-breakers to him by Friday. Keep this off Slack channels with external guests. The confidential deal outline sits just below this note.

confidential, kajof-tahof: The pricing group signed off on a budget of $491.8 million for Project Casvan.